>Subject: [dpdk-dev] [RFC v2 4/5] spinlock: use wfe to reduce contention
>on aarch64
>
>In acquiring a spinlock, cores repeatedly poll the lock variable.
>This is replaced by rte_wait_until_equal API.
>
>5~10% performance gain was measured by running spinlock_autotest
>on
>14 isolated cores of ThunderX2.

>+/* armv7a does support WFE, but an explicit wake-up signal using SEV
>is
>+ * required (must be preceded by DSB to drain the store buffer) and
>+ * this is less performant, so keep armv7a implementation unchanged.
>+ */
>+#if defined(RTE_USE_WFE) && defined(RTE_ARCH_ARM64)
>+static inline void
>+rte_spinlock_lock(rte_spinlock_t *sl)
>+{
>+      unsigned int tmp;
>+      /*
>http://infocenter.arm.com/help/index.jsp?topic=/com.arm.doc.
>+       * faqs/ka16809.html
>+       */
>+      asm volatile(
>+              "sevl\n"
>+              "1:     wfe\n"
>+              "2:     ldaxr %w[tmp], %w[locked]\n"
>+              "cbnz   %w[tmp], 1b\n"
>+              "stxr   %w[tmp], %w[one], %w[locked]\n"
>+              "cbnz   %w[tmp], 2b\n"
>+              : [tmp] "=&r" (tmp), [locked] "+Q"(sl->locked)
>+              : [one] "r" (1)
>+              : "cc", "memory");
>+}
>+#endif
